Edit PID Threshold:
Name:
The name of the PID threshold template
Description:
Text field that should contain a meaningful description of the threshold template
PID Threshold Parameters:
Selection:
The user selects if the requirements should apply for a specific PID or for all
PIDs of a specified type. Note that the PID type detection depends on correct
PSI/SI/PSIP signalling.
PID:
The PID for which the specified requirements apply. If a PID type is selected in
the ‘Match’ column this field will update to read N/A when the
Apply changes
button is clicked.
Description:
A text field describing the PID or PID type requirement
Require pres.:
If this field is checked an alarm will be raised provided that the specified PID
is not present in the transport stream. Note that this check is only available for
specified PIDs and not for PID types.
Monitor min BW:
An alarm is raised if the PID bandwidth goes below the specified minimum
bandwidth (bandwidth in kbit/s or Mbit/s) and monitoring is enabled.
Monitor max BW:
An alarm is raised if the maximum PID bandwidth specified is exceeded (band-
width in kbit/s or Mbit/s) and monitoring is enabled.
Req. language:
If the PID need to have a certain language code signalled in the language
descriptor it can be set here. An alarm will be raised if a wrong language is
signalled or if the language is not signalled.
Ignore CC:
Select a scheduling template different from ‘Never’ for the probe to ignore CC
errors for the specified PID or PID type.
Ignore missing:
Select a scheduling template different from ‘Never’ for the probe to ignore that
the specified PID or PID type is signalled in PSI but missing in the stream.
Ignore PCR:
Select a scheduling template different from ‘Never’ for the probe to ignore any
PCR errors for this PID or PID type.
Ignore unref.:
Select a scheduling template different from ‘Never’ for the probe to ignore that
the specified PID is present in the stream but unreferenced in PSI.
Ignore all:
Select a scheduling template different from ‘Never’ for the probe to ignore all
errors for a specified PID or PID type.
Scrambling:
An alarm will be raised provided that the specified PID is scrambled when ‘require
clr’ has been selected. Similarly an alarm will be raised if the specified PID is
clear when ‘require scr’ has been selected. The default setting is to ignore
whether the PID or PID type is scrambled or not.
